Topological Symmetry Enhanced Graph Convolution for Skeleton-Based Action Recognition
TSE-GCN uses symmetry-aware graph reactivation and per-frame deformable temporal convolution to reach 90.0 and 91.1 percent on NTU RGB+D 120 with 4.4 million parameters.
